About The Position

The Salesforce Systems Support Analyst is a key member of the maintenance organization. This role is responsible for providing administration and optimization of the Agentforce Field Service platform launching across the maintenance organization. This new team member serves as a key point of contact for internal users, ensuring system stability, usability, and alignment with business operations. They will work cross-functionally with other analysts and IT Teams across Penske. Their primary responsibilities include supporting day-to-day system usage, troubleshooting issues, gathering enhancement requests, and configuring front end Salesforce solutions to meet evolving business needs. The Analyst collaborates closely with internal stakeholders to improve workflows, maintain data integrity, and drive system adoption. This role also plays a critical part in user enablement through training, documentation, and continuous improvement initiatives, while ensuring alignment with organizational processes and best practices.

Requirements

  • Serve as the primary support resource and subject matter expert for Salesforce users in the maintenance organization, resolving issues, answering questions, and ensuring effective system utilization.
  • Configure and maintain Salesforce to support internal business processes, including implementing enhancements based on user needs.
  • Translate business requirements into system configurations and functional solutions. Partner with stakeholders to prioritize and implement system improvements.
  • Build and maintain Salesforce reports and dashboards to support operational and leadership decision-making.
  • Monitor system performance, troubleshoot defects, and coordinate resolutions with internal teams.
  • Analyze system data and user trends to identify opportunities for optimization and efficiency improvements.
  • Read and write SQL queries through foundational knowledge of relational databases (e.g., MySQL, PostgreSQL, or SQL Server)
  • Provide support during high-demand periods and assist with special projects as needed.
  • Work cross-functionally with operations, IT, and business teams to align Salesforce capabilities with business needs.
  • Partner with Salesforce IT developers to deliver advanced automation and agentic solutions.
  • Develop and maintain job aids, documentation, and training materials to support end users.
  • Conduct onboarding and ongoing training sessions to improve user adoption and system effectiveness.
